Population in Prudnicki County 2023
In 2023, Prudnicki county ranked 288 of 380 Polish counties. Population shrank by 4,081 residents -7.35% between 2018-2023, at 51,443.
Among 339 declining counties, in the bottom 20% for rate of decline. Within Opole province, ranked 10 of 12 counties.
Based on 31 years of official GUS statistics for Prudnicki county and its 4 municipalities within Opole province.
